-build asp.netコア2.2を学習道路ドッキングウィンドウは、警告MSB3245を生成します。この参照に間違った解決策を解決できませんでした。

時々、私たちは直接、時間がドッキングウィンドウでミラーを構築することが、次のエラーが発生した場合DOTNETを公開する時にドッカビルドを公開しますが、使用することができます。

解決策ます。https://stackoverflow.com/questions/14261412/could-not-resolve-this-reference-could-not-locate-the-assembly

答案的原文如下:あなたが最も可能性が高い。このメッセージを得るとき、それはもはや存在しないアセンブリの古い場所へのプロジェクトのポイント。あなたが一度それを構築することができましたので、アセンブリは、すでにあなたの中にコピーされましたbin\Debug/ bin\Releaseあなたのプロジェクトがまだコピーを見つけることができるようにフォルダ。

あなたはソリューションエクスプローラでプロジェクトの参照ノードを開くと、参照の隣に黄色のアイコンがあるはずです。参照を削除し、正しい場所から再度追加します。

あなたはそれがから参照された場所を知りたい場合は、テキストエディタで.csprojファイルを開き、探しする必要があると思いますHintPathそのアセンブリのために-いくつかの理由のためのIDEは、この情報は表示されません。

.cspjファイル内の警告サイン黄色の線が黄色の線は、(それが削除された特定のパッケージ参照に、である)行が削除マークし、その後、再引用このパッケージはすることができ、私が持っているものということを警告した後、そこにある旨のそこに問題があるので、彼が削除され、その後、私はnugetでそれを再ダウンロード例えばマップ、Microsoft.AspNetCOre.Http.Abstractionsこのパッケージ、問題が解決されます。

おすすめ

転載: www.cnblogs.com/pangjianxin/p/11084996.html